.hero.svelte-1mrs6cv .thumbnail.svelte-1mrs6cv.svelte-1mrs6cv{position:absolute;top:0;right:0;bottom:0;left:0;overflow:hidden;background-color:#f7f8fc}.hero.svelte-1mrs6cv .thumbnail.svelte-1mrs6cv.svelte-1mrs6cv: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0}.hero.svelte-1mrs6cv .thumbnail.svelte-1mrs6cv>img.svelte-1mrs6cv{position:absolute;top:50%;right:50%;bottom:50%;left:50%;translate:-50% -50%;opacity:.15;filter:grayscale(100%);mix-blend-mode:hard-light;transition:filter .6s ease-out}.article-grid.svelte-1mrs6cv.svelte-1mrs6cv.svelte-1mrs6cv{display:grid;-moz-column-gap:5rem;column-gap:5rem;row-gap:5rem;grid-template-columns:3fr 1fr;grid-template-areas:"content right"}@media all and (min-width: 96rem){.article-grid.svelte-1mrs6cv.svelte-1mrs6cv.svelte-1mrs6cv{grid-template-columns:.125fr 42rem 1fr;grid-template-areas:"left content right";-moz-column-gap:8rem;column-gap:8rem}}@media all and (max-width: 48rem){.article-grid.svelte-1mrs6cv.svelte-1mrs6cv.svelte-1mrs6cv{grid-template-columns:1fr;grid-template-areas:"content"}.article-grid.svelte-1mrs6cv .article-body.svelte-1mrs6cv.svelte-1mrs6cv{max-width:calc(100vw - 2rem)}}.article-body.svelte-1mrs6cv.svelte-1mrs6cv.svelte-1mrs6cv{grid-area:content;font-size:1.125rem;line-height:1.7em}.article-body.svelte-1mrs6cv>.content.svelte-1mrs6cv.svelte-1mrs6cv{max-width:44rem;margin-inline:auto}.article-body.svelte-1mrs6cv>.content.svelte-1mrs6cv>div{max-width:100%}.article-body.svelte-1mrs6cv img{max-width:100%}.article-body.svelte-1mrs6cv h2{margin-block:10rem 3rem}.article-body.svelte-1mrs6cv h2:first-child{margin-block-start:0}.article-body.svelte-1mrs6cv h2:last-child:not(:first-child){margin-block-end:0}.article-body.svelte-1mrs6cv h3{margin-block:10rem 3rem}.article-body.svelte-1mrs6cv h3:first-child{margin-block-start:0}.article-body.svelte-1mrs6cv h3:last-child:not(:first-child){margin-block-end:0}.article-body.svelte-1mrs6cv h4{margin-block:10rem 3rem}.article-body.svelte-1mrs6cv h4:first-child{margin-block-start:0}.article-body.svelte-1mrs6cv h4:last-child:not(:first-child){margin-block-end:0}.article-body.svelte-1mrs6cv p{margin-block:2.5rem 2.5rem;font-size:1.125rem;line-height:1.7em}.article-body.svelte-1mrs6cv p:first-child{margin-block-start:0}.article-body.svelte-1mrs6cv p:last-child:not(:first-child){margin-block-end:0}.article-body.svelte-1mrs6cv blockquote{margin-block:6rem 3rem;margin-inline:2rem 0rem;font-weight:299;font-size:1.75rem;font-family:Sora,sans-serif;letter-spacing:normal;line-height:1.2em}.article-body.svelte-1mrs6cv blockquote:first-child{margin-block-start:0}.article-body.svelte-1mrs6cv blockquote:last-child:not(:first-child){margin-block-end:0}@media all and (max-width: 40rem){.article-body.svelte-1mrs6cv blockquote{font-size:2rem}}@media all and (min-width: 40rem){.article-body.svelte-1mrs6cv blockquote{font-size:1.75rem}}.article-body.svelte-1mrs6cv .profile{margin-block-end:6rem}aside.svelte-1mrs6cv.svelte-1mrs6cv.svelte-1mrs6cv{align-self:start;grid-area:right;font-size:1rem;line-height:1.5em;position:sticky}
